Abdi Dalem Experience

Experience an authentic and immersive experience through the Abdi Dalem Experience program at Keraton Yogyakarta. In this tour, you are invited to dive into the traditions, culture and local wisdom that are part of the life of the courtiers, the guardians of the noble values of the kingdom.

Keraton Yogyakarta is a vibrant center of Javanese cultural heritage, where the history, arts, and traditions of the kingdom are preserved and maintained. The palace is also open to the public through cultural and educational activities.

Itinerary

Activity 1

Activity 1 - Wanuh Busana

In this session, male participants will wear one of Abdi Dalem jaler's outfits, peranakan. This outfit consists of dark blue lurik, blangkon, nyamping, and other accessories.

Meanwhile, female participants will wear one of the Abdi Dalem estri outfits consisting of plain or patterned kebaya tangkeban, nyamping, and other accessories complemented by a bun arrangement.

Activity 2

Activity 2 - Marak Sowan

Becak is a mode of transportation that is often used by the Abdi Dalem because they live in the area around the Royal Fort. A becak will take you to the Pelataran Keben area for the Marak Sowan session and continue to the next activity.

Activity 3

Activity 3 - Trap Sila

Trap Sila or Abdi Dalem behavior is manifested in the way of walking, as well as ethics when entering/exiting the room, as well as entering/exiting the Ward.

In Bangsal Pancaniti, you will be invited to learn the ethics and behavior that must be considered by an Abdi Dalem. Enjoy the experience of learning this interesting etiquette before entering the inner area of the Palace.

Take a closer look at the duties and responsibilities of the Abdi Dalem from the Pelataran keben area to the inner area of the palace. End the day with a visit to the Conservation Laboratory and the exciting experience of nyungging batik.

Activity 4

Activity 4 - Conservation Laboratory

You are invited to witness the efforts of the conservators of the Keraton Yogyakarta in preserving the historical value of various objects belonging to the Keraton Yogyakarta.

Activity 5

Activity 5 - Nyungging Batik

In this session, you will be introduced to Awisan Dalem batik motifs (forbidden motifs) in the Keraton Yogyakarta as well as drawing Batik motifs on cloth called nyungging or nyorek.
